What Is the Pilfer Game?
Pilfer is a multiplayer word-building game centered around creating, modifying, and stealing words. The game’s primary objective is to build valid words using available letters while simultaneously watching for opportunities to transform words already created by other players. When a player successfully changes an existing word into a new valid word, ownership of that word transfers to the new player.
This innovative word-stealing mechanic separates Pilfer from many traditional vocabulary games. Instead of simply forming words independently, players must constantly monitor the entire game board and adapt to changing situations. Every word created becomes both an opportunity and a target.
The game’s dynamic structure ensures that players remain actively engaged throughout the match. A word that seems secure one moment may suddenly be transformed and stolen by another player. This constant interaction creates excitement and unpredictability that keeps players focused from beginning to end.

How the Pilfer Game Works
At the beginning of a typical Pilfer match, players receive access to a shared pool of letters. Using these letters, they attempt to create valid words recognized by the game’s dictionary. Once a word is created, it becomes part of the active playing area where other players can potentially interact with it.
The most distinctive feature occurs when players identify opportunities to modify existing words. By adding letters and rearranging possibilities within the game’s rules, a player may transform another participant’s word into a completely new valid word. When this happens, the word changes ownership and contributes to the new player’s score.
Because words remain vulnerable throughout much of the game, players must think strategically about every decision. Creating a long word may generate points, but it can also provide opportunities for opponents to extend and steal it. This balance between offense and defense creates a deeper strategic experience than many conventional word games.

Popular Strategies Used by Experienced Players
Experienced Pilfer players rarely focus solely on creating the longest possible words. Instead, they consider how each word fits into the broader context of the match. Many advanced players deliberately create words that are difficult to modify, reducing the likelihood that opponents can steal them.
Another effective strategy involves recognizing expandable word structures. Players who understand common prefixes and suffixes can quickly transform existing words into new variations. This knowledge creates numerous opportunities for successful steals and point accumulation.
Timing is another critical element of high-level play. Skilled competitors often wait for the ideal moment to act rather than immediately making every available move. By observing opponents and preserving valuable options, they can execute stronger plays that produce greater long-term advantages.
